&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;A.M. Dellamonica&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; or &am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Alyx Dellamonica&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a Canadian science fiction writer who has published over forty short stories in the field since the 1980s. Dellamonica writes in a number of subgenres including science fiction, fantasy, and alternate history. Their stories have been selected for &amp;quot;Year&amp;#039;s Best&amp;quot; science fiction anthologies in 2002 and 2007.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
They attended Clarion West Writers Workshop in 1995&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Locus 2019 interview&amp;quot;/&amp;gt; and they are a student in the UBC Opt-Res Creative Writing MFA program.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Dellamonica teaches creative writing online at the UCLA Extension Writer&amp;#039;s Program and in person at UTSC. They also review science fiction novels and write articles about publishing for science fiction related websites like Clarkesworld and for &amp;#039;&amp;#039;tor.com&amp;#039;&amp;#039;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Their first novel, &amp;#039;&amp;#039;Indigo Springs&amp;#039;&amp;#039;, was published by Tor Books in November 2009. Their fourth novel, &amp;#039;&amp;#039;A Daughter of No Nation&amp;#039;&amp;#039;, was published in December 2015. Dellamonica&amp;#039;s most recent novel is their fifth, &amp;#039;&amp;#039;The Nature of a Pirate.&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&lt;br /&gt;

==Nominations and awards==&lt;br /&gt;
Dellamonica&amp;#039;s Joan of Arc alternate history story &amp;quot;A Key to the Illuminated Heretic&amp;quot; was nominated for the 2005 Sidewise Award for Alternate History&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.uchronia.net/sidewise/complete.html#2005 2005 Sidewise Awards Finalists]&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; and was on the 2005 Nebula Ballot.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.sfwa.org/news/2007/06nebprelim.htm 2006 Preliminary Nebula Award Ballot] {{webarchive |url=https://web.archive.org/web/20071013204038/http://www.sfwa.org/news/2007/06nebprelim.htm |date=October 13, 2007 }}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; In 2005, they received the Canada Council for the Arts&amp;#039; Grant for Emerging Artists&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.canadacouncil.ca/grants/recipients/#Canada Council for the Arts Searchable Grants Listing] {{webarchive |url=https://web.archive.org/web/20100928151009/http://www.canadacouncil.ca/grants/recipients/#Canada |date=September 28, 2010 }}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
and in 2015 they received the Ontario Arts Council Grant for Writers&amp;#039; Works in Progress. Dellamonica&amp;#039;s first novel, &amp;#039;&amp;#039;Indigo Springs&amp;#039;&amp;#039;, was awarded the 2010 Sunburst Award for Canadian Literature of the Fantastic.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.sunburstaward.org/content/2010-sunburst-winners#2010 Sunburst Award Winners] {{webarchive |url=https://web.archive.org/web/20101108095737/http://www.sunburstaward.org/content/2010-sunburst-winners#2010 |date=November 8, 2010 }}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; In 2016, their fourth novel &amp;#039;&amp;#039;A Daughter of No Nation&amp;#039;&amp;#039; won the Prix Aurora Award for Best Novel.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;[http://www.locusmag.com/News/2016/08/2016-aurora-awards-winners/ 2016 Aurora Award Winners]&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
